San Francisco and Aconite

Don't Be Afraid of Me

"Chanyeol!" I knelt down next to him, touching his back gently. Chanyeol winced, still on his side, and Baekhyun growled at me.

"Oh, get over it! I’m trying to help him, go snarl at someone else, diva." I snapped, making Baekhyun abruptly shut his mouth with a surprised look. I saw Suho hiding a small smile before kneeling beside Chanyeol.

"Come on, stand up." Suho said softly, helping Chanyeol up. The tall wolf winced, touching his back gently. Suho lifted his shirt, revealing a bruise on the middle of his back and making Baekhyun wince.

"Come on, we need to get back to camp. God knows how Tao, Xiumin and Chen are." Suho frowned, hurrying us along. Chanyeol walked stiffly because of his back, and I walked beside him.

"I’m sorry about Luke." I said. Chanyeol shook his head, signaling he wasn’t angry at me, but I still frowned. All I had done was hurt these boys, and it made me feel terrible.

"You sure put Baekhyun in his place." Chanyeol said softly with a small smile. I nodded, wondering at how they could joke when so many pack members were hurt. But I supposed this was just the way Chanyeol was, always happy.

"No one’s ever done that!" Chanyeol continued. I smiled a little, and we trooped into camp. I saw immediately Xiumin, Chen, Tao and Sehun stretched out on the ground by the stream. Yixing was kneeling in between Xiumin and Chen, looking exhausted.

"Chanyeol, Baekhyun, Skye! Come over, I need you!" Yixing called, waving his hands. Suho followed, and Kris was already kneeling by Tao.

"Yes, what can we do?" I said, sitting by him. Yixing already swayed with exhaustion-from taking Sehun’s pain earlier-and he looked grey.

"I only have enough strength right now to heal internal injuries. Everything else, just bandage it up for now. I’ll heal it tomorrow." Yixing said. We nodded, and I went over to Tao.

"I’m just going to take this out and bandage it up, okay?" I asked Kris, pointing to the knife. He nodded, hovering protectively, and I pulled gently on the knife. Tao was already unconscious, but he moaned slightly.

"I’m sorry." I murmured, hating to cause him pain. The knife came out with a sound and blood pooled rapidly under his side. I took a bandage from the pile next to Yixing-god knows how they got bandages-and made a thick pad out of it. I placed it against the wound, coiling more bandages around his side to hold it in place.

I rinsed my hands in the stream, and felt a soft touch on my shoulder. I turned around, seeing Kris looking at me with softened eyes, and gave him a questioning look.

"Thank you. For everything. I’m glad we have you with us." Kris said, surprising me. I didn’t really ever think he liked me, but apparently he was just a tough guy on the outside.

I smiled softly, touched. It’s funny, I used to hate them so much, all of them. Now, I didn’t think about what they really were. To me, they were just people. I encased Kris in a hug, surprising the tallest wolf, but he hugged me back gently.

"It’s no problem Kris. I’m glad I can help." I said, patting Tao gently. After that, I went as soon as possible to Xiumin and Yixing.

"Is he okay?" I asked, kneeling down. Yixing his lips, eyes almost closing, and shook his head.

"I don’t know. Your...roommate was a good shot. I think there was something in the bullets too, they’re both getting sick." Yixing said, gesturing at Chen and Xiumin. Suho and Lu Han were sitting by Chen, wiping away the blood streaming from the wound in his chest. It was turning a weird shade of black, and I saw similar liquid coming from the wound right in between Xiumin’s collarbones.

"Lu Han, I’m ready for you." Yixing called softly. The slim boy nodded, coming over and sitting by us. I watched as he focused hard, drawing his hand up and closing his eyes. Xiumin whimpered and there was a sound as a bullet slowly wormed its way back out of the wound. When it finally shot into Lu Han’s hand he relaxed, holding it out for Suho. Suho took it, rolling it around in his palm, and nodded.

"Aconite. You were right, Yixing." I looked between them, confused, and Yixing nodded. He rested his hand on Xiumin’s wound, drawing all the black liquid out. It dripped sluggishly and I winced, helping to sop it up with bandages.

"Gross." I whispered, frowning at Xiumin. Poor guy, this was all because of Luke.

"It’s wolfsbane. It’ll kill them both if I don’t get it out." Yixing said softly, stopping when Xiumin’s blood returned to red. I quickly bandaged him like Tao, and Yixing turned to Chen. Lu Han removed the bullet again, and Yixing got rid of the poison.

Jongin came over and sat by me, silent. He called Chanyeol over when Xiumin started shaking, and Chanyeol slowly heated Xiumin back up. By now he was blazing with fever, like Chen, and Chanyeol and Suho were frantically going between the two to keep them comfortable.

We worked long into the night, me keeping the bandages clean, and Chanyeol, Yixing, Suho and Lu Han helping to get rid of wolfsbane and keep their temperatures under control. Baekhyun stood by silently, supplying us with steady light that made the clearing bright as day.

Finally, the sun started clearing the trees and Yixing collapsed from exhaustion. The combination of using his healing and staying up all night completely drained him, and Suho carried him towards the fire still going and laid him down on the grass. Sometime during the night I had learned the bandages had been the boys’ shirts, and I was now faced with the early morning sight of 12 shirtless werewolves strolling around and tending to Xiumin and Chen.

Tao was already doing much better-werewolf healing-and he was awake to eat food that Kyungsoo made. Sehun was awake too and bouncing around from post-change energy. Since he had changed yesterday, he wouldn’t change on the full moon tonight and I could stay with him.

"Guys." I said, thinking of something. All of them turned to me, some boys’ wolf ears flicking (okay, it was adorable), and gave me questioning looks.

"If you’re changing tonight, shouldn’t we avoid San Francisco? You guys need supplies, so Sehun and I could just go into town tonight and get what you need, and we go immediately up to, like, Canada or something tomorrow." I suggested. Suho cocked his head to the side, considering, then he nodded.

"Good idea. Okay." Suho said. He turned to Sehun with a stern look, then nodded at Lu Han. "Lu Han, I want you to go too. You’re the second oldest after Xiumin, and you have the most control with resisting the change."

"Okay." Lu Han nodded, looking confident.

"Keep them safe, and come straight back here tomorrow morning. Okay?" Suho said. We all nodded, and he reached deep in his jeans pocket (biceps rippling, I might add) and he handed me a wad of cash.

"For your expenses. Be sure to pick up some shirts if you can." Suho said. I nodded, and he sent us off immediately. I waited for Sehun and Lu Han to say goodbye to everyone, and was surprised when everyone came up to say goodbye to me too.

"Stay safe, okay?" Chanyeol said worriedly, crushing me in a huge hug. I nodded, hugging him back cautiously, and was surprised when Baekhyun touched his cheek to mine next. I had seen the wolves greet each other this way, rubbing cheeks together, but no one had ever done it me. I jerked a little back, and Baekhyun nodded.

"Be careful." Baekhyun said. I nodded, and I waited while the rest of the wolves said goodbye in this way. I could still feel the warmth of their breath when Lu Han and Sehun and I took off towards San Francisco. This would be a definite first.

We reached San Francisco by stowing away on the back of a truck as it crossed over the Golden Gate. The once magnificent bridge was tattered and swaying in the wind, and fog blanketed the city. We hopped off soon, strolling quietly into a small supermarket.

Sehun, of course, was bouncing around excitedly everywhere. I left him and Lu Han outside due to their shirtless state, and went inside picking up rice and other food that wouldn’t go bad. I also got some shirts, backpacks, water bottles and blankets and paid for everything quickly.

Going outside, I looked around for the boys. With so many humans around, I was worried they would freak out. And there were people, strolling the streets like I remembered. The only clue I wasn’t in the past were the half-destroyed streets and the new massive wall that stretched around the city.

"Lu Han! Sehun!" I called as loudly as I dared, looking around. There were plenty of alleyways they could’ve gone into, and I walked inside the nearest one carefully. It was really dark, and I wished Baekhyun were here to help me see.

I reached the end and started to turn around, pausing when several figures blocked my way. I paused, sizing up the five boys who blocked my path. They stared at me too, and I crossed my arms.

"Are you lost?" one of them, who looked the youngest, asked. I shook my head, taking them in carefully. They looked human, and seemed nice, but I knew not to trust appearances.

"No. I’m fine." I said, stepping forward. The tallest one moved to block me, shaking his head.

"It’s dangerous for a woman to roam the streets alone now. We’ll walk you back to your house. I’m Seunghyun." Seunghyun smiled at me, his incredibly deep voice even lower than Chanyeol and Kris’.

"No, it’s really fine. I’m from out of town, so I don’t have a house." I said. The last thing I needed was these boys following me and finding Lu Han and Sehun.

"We’ll walk you to your hotel, then. I’m Jiyong." another boy stepped forward with a kind smile, and I saw he was much smaller than Seunghyun.

"I’m Daesung." a third boy introduced himself, then pointed at the boy who had asked me if I was lost. "This is Seungri."

"Hello!" Seungri smiled cutely, dimpling. The last boy still looked kind of intimidating, but it changed immediately when he gave me a wide eyesmile and tilted his head to the side.

"I’m Taeyang." Taeyang said. I nodded, trying to push past them once again, and Seungri blocked my way.

"Come on, we’ll walk you." Seungri said. I shook my head, trying to think of a way out of this. And where the hell were Lu Han and Sehun?!

"Oh, uhm...the thing is, I’m not staying in a hotel. I can’t afford it." l lied quickly, hoping this would make them go away. No one wanted to hang out with a homeless girl, and I was sure these boys would leave immediately.

"It’s okay, you can stay with us. We have an apartment you can stay at for however long you need." Jiyong said immediately, and the rest agreed enthusiastically.

"I really can’t, I have to go..." I trailed off. Why was this going so wrong? Moreover, why were these boys so damn nice?

"Nonsense. My mother didn’t raise me to let a young woman stay by herself on the streets. It gets cold at night, for god’s sake." Seunghyun said solemnly. I cursed mentally. I couldn’t leave Sehun and Lu Han alone in this city, they could be killed.

"Come on, let’s get you some food." Jiyong said. Taeyang took my shopping bags and Seungri looped his arm through mine, virtually dragging me with them.

I watched helplessly as we walked further away from where I had left Lu Han and Sehun. I frowned, and we arrived soon in front of a three story apartment building. We went inside quickly, the boys giving me a small tour. I nodded, still thinking all the while of Lu Han and Sehun. Boys, where are you? I cried in my head. Kris would kill me if I lost them...
